The aYa is a safety unit designed to clarify and disinfect clear, low-particulate water without chlorination. In the event of deterioration of mains water, it offers a highly practical solution for securing water at the point of use. With its compact design, the aYa preserves the natural minerals present in water and blocks viruses, bacteria and suspended particles.
With a production capacity of up to 1m3/h, it eliminates the need for a large number of plastic bottles, and is perfectly suited to the safe drinking water needs of public buildings.
For water security efficient and sustainable
The aYa operates without consumables or chemicals, and requires very little maintenance. It is controlled by a PLC that manages the production and backwashing phases, giving the operator a high degree of autonomy.

Did you know? In most cases, it's chlorine that gives water its taste. Chlorine is a molecule used in water treatment plants to prevent the growth of bacteria during transport to the point of use. aYa does not use chlorine, but attenuates the taste of chlorine without eliminating it, in order to maintain its sanitary properties.
The prerequisites for installing an aYa are as follows:
- Provide a space of about 1m².
- Be close to an electrical outlet
- Have a connection to the drinking water network (EDCH) and a discharge.
- Maintain a minimum pressure of 2 bar
*ECHD: Eaux Destinées à la Consommation Humaine (water intended for human consumption)
The need for remineralization depends on the quality of the raw water prior to treatment. Thanks to ultrafiltration, our water treatment units preserve the minerals naturally present in water and essential to good health. On the other hand, if the raw water is poorly mineralized, we can add a remineralization module to our units to improve water quality and provide more essential nutrients.
